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/typescript/9.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Reactjs 使用reach路由器识别初始登录页_Reactjs_Typescript_Reach Router - Fatal编程技术网

Reactjs 使用reach路由器识别初始登录页

Reactjs 使用reach路由器识别初始登录页,reactjs,typescript,reach-router,Reactjs,Typescript,Reach Router,我正在尝试将后退光标添加到我的应用程序中。返回光标应位于除登录页以外的所有页面上 问题是我的应用程序有两种可能的流程,因此用户可以从登录页a或登录页B(取决于流程)输入应用程序 使用reach路由器,是否有办法确定一个页面是否是用户到达的第一个页面?在“返回光标”组件中,使用react路由器中的useLocation,检查是否是“登录页面”路径,并在它是时将其隐藏。在组件装载上检查窗口.location.pathname,并相应地呈现“返回”按钮

我正在尝试将后退光标添加到我的应用程序中。返回光标应位于除登录页以外的所有页面上

问题是我的应用程序有两种可能的流程,因此用户可以从登录页a或登录页B(取决于流程)输入应用程序


使用reach路由器,是否有办法确定一个页面是否是用户到达的第一个页面?

在“返回光标”组件中,使用react路由器中的useLocation,检查是否是“登录页面”路径,并在它是时将其隐藏。在组件装载上检查
窗口.location.pathname
,并相应地呈现“返回”按钮